Action item from the Mirewater tide-table widget incident. Owner: release manager. Widget cached stale harbor offsets after the DST change, showing tides six hours off for two days. Required: add a cache-invalidation check to the release checklist, block deploys when offset tables are older than 24 hours, and verify the Saltgate harbor feed before each cut. Deadline: next release. Checklist template and sign-off procedure are documented on the internal page below.

wiki page, kawif-bajep: https://artifactory.zarqelforge.internal/issue/browse/display/display/projects/spaces/secrets/000fe6ec5a46af29355003e1

# Constants for the Thistledown CSV import wizard.
# Keep it simple: the parser streams rows, validates headers against
# the Marrowfield schema, and batches inserts. Don't raise batch size
# without checking memory on the worker tier — it OOMs fast. Rejected
# rows go to a quarantine file, capped per upload. Encoding detection
# samples the first chunk only. If you touch these, rerun the fixture
# suite. The tuning values are defined immediately below.

limits module of yadug-tawip:
QUOTAS = {
    "julael": 705,
    "kasael": 903,
    "druwyn": 489,
}

Subject: Key rotation for RenderPulse — action required

Hi support team,

As part of our template rendering performance work, we are rotating the credentials for RenderPulse, the internal service that benchmarks partial-template compile times. The old key will stop working on Friday at noon. Please update any local diagnostic scripts that query the render-timing endpoints, since stale credentials will surface as 401 errors rather than timing data. Cached dashboards will refresh automatically.

The new key to use going forward is below.

app token of kafop-hahaf = kto11_iRLdsMBafGn